🐛 bug report

Description of the problem (similar to #3139)

I can't change the color theme in the preferences also it is said to set as custom but the option is not available in safari (so I am using chrome)...
option available ->
"workbench.colorTheme": "Custom Theme"
option required in the documentation ->
"workbench.colorTheme": "custom",
